<title>ui-ci: let a ci-filter decide whether the tab is shown</title>
<updated>2026-07-30T05:27:31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Saya Andy</name>
<email>saya.andy@posteo.com</email>
</author>
<published>2026-07-30T05:27:31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://sayag.it/cgitext.git/commit/?id=7162aef3344a4f4f2d7edd2f214d805bd744c20c'/>
<id>urn:sha1:7162aef3344a4f4f2d7edd2f214d805bd744c20c</id>
<content type='text'>
cgit cannot know whether the ref being viewed actually has a pipeline, so
the "ci" tab is offered for every ref and only reveals a missing one once
followed. Probing the ci system from cgit is not an option: the tab is
part of the page header, so it would mean a blocking request for every
page of every repository, cgit links no http client, and job pages are
usually not readable anonymously.

Add a ci filter instead, which receives the ref, whether it is a branch or
a tag, and the expanded url, and answers with its exit status. This keeps
credentials, timeouts and caching in a script, where they belong;
filters/ci-jenkins.sh demonstrates all three against Jenkins' REST API.

The verdict is memoized, so the filter runs once per request rather than
once for the tab and again for the redirect, and it governs the page as
well as the tab, so a hidden tab cannot be reached by typing the url.

<title>cgit: truncate all config values at the newline</title>
<updated>2026-05-04T16:28:27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Jason A. Donenfeld</name>
<email>Jason@zx2c4.com</email>
</author>
<published>2026-05-04T16:13:13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://sayag.it/cgitext.git/commit/?id=ed05b1054df10a2fbc68000cfdd429daec03a456'/>
<id>urn:sha1:ed05b1054df10a2fbc68000cfdd429daec03a456</id>
<content type='text'>
These would be largely invalid anyway (save, I suppose, for Linux file
paths that technically can contain new lines).

The actual problem is that these get printed back out into cached -- and
trusted -- cgitrc files, and if the fields have newlines, the git-config
way of less trusted users configuring repos on a shared system can be
abused to inject newlines, which then can be used to smuggle global
options (including filters, which execute code) into the cached cgitrc.

So now, only ever duplicate up to the newline, when dealing with these
inputs.

<title>filter: don't use dlsym unnecessarily</title>
<updated>2015-08-13T13:39:06Z</updated>
<author>
<name>John Keeping</name>
<email>john@keeping.me.uk</email>
</author>
<published>2015-08-13T11:14:20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://sayag.it/cgitext.git/commit/?id=0c4d76755b98bb597279a1930bf4c69eca7dde62'/>
<id>urn:sha1:0c4d76755b98bb597279a1930bf4c69eca7dde62</id>
<content type='text'>
We only need to hook write() if Lua filter's are in use.  If support has
been disabled, remove the dependency on dlsym().

<title>repolist: add owner-filter</title>
<updated>2014-12-24T02:08:20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Chris Burroughs</name>
<email>chris.burroughs@gmail.com</email>
</author>
<published>2014-08-04T13:23:08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://sayag.it/cgitext.git/commit/?id=96ceb9a95a7a321209cff347fefd141a9fffc7ca'/>
<id>urn:sha1:96ceb9a95a7a321209cff347fefd141a9fffc7ca</id>
<content type='text'>
This allows custom links to be used for repository owners by
configuring a filter to be applied in the "Owner" column in the
repository list.
